Key concepts and overview

At the core of the slot gaming experience are several key concepts that define how these games operate and appeal to players. Slots are primarily based on chance, with random number generators (RNGs) ensuring fair play and unpredictability. The appeal of slots lies in their simplicity, allowing players to engage without needing extensive knowledge or skills. Popular slots often feature captivating themes, high-quality graphics, and immersive sound effects that enhance the overall gaming experience. Additionally, the integration of bonus features, such as free spins and multipliers, adds layers of excitement and potential rewards for players.

Main features and details

Modern slot machines come equipped with a variety of features that contribute to their popularity. One of the most significant components is the payline structure, which determines how players can win. Traditional slots typically have a limited number of paylines, while contemporary video slots may offer hundreds or even thousands of ways to win. Furthermore, the introduction of progressive jackpots has revolutionized the industry, allowing players to compete for life-changing sums of money. Another critical aspect is the volatility of the slots, which refers to the risk level associated with a particular game. High volatility slots may offer larger payouts but less frequently, while low volatility slots provide smaller, more consistent wins.
